Here's a brief rundown:
1. The Player's Companion is finishing its development cycle - all the new classes and races are done, the class creation guidelines are done, we're now trying out Alex's brilliant guidelines for creating new spells. It will be ready for in PDF for backers in June, with general sale PDFs a little later and print available in stores about 2 months after that.
2. The Dwimmermount mega-dungeon, ACKS version. The PDF seems likely to be ready in late summer/early fall, with print available 2-3 months later.
3. At the Autarch forums Alex says the Auran Empire setting will be due either Christmas 2012 or next year, and:
4. Domains at War. "This is close to complete. I would expect this around the same time as Dwimmermount."
Those are the major releases but I also have some projects cooking which may be just short PDFs at first.
